CI Investments Inc's Q1 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2024, CI Investments Inc held 1,325 positions worth $25.2B, up 30% from $19.3B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 41% of the portfolio.

CI Investments Inc deployed $3.65B of net new capital in Q1 2024, opening 59 new positions and adding to 855 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Shares China Large-Cap ETF: 1,377,143 shares worth $33.1M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 21% of assets, down from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Humana, an estimated $117M trimmed.
